PsPing features and specs

  • Versatile Functionality
    PsPing supports ICMP ping, TCP ping, latency and bandwidth measurement, making it a comprehensive tool for network diagnostics.
  • Command-Line Interface
    Being a command-line tool, PsPing is suitable for automation and scripting, allowing users to integrate it into batch files or other automated systems.
  • Detailed Output
    PsPing provides detailed statistics on latency and throughput, which can aid in thorough network analysis and troubleshooting.
  • Ease of Use
    It is straightforward to use for those familiar with command-line tools, providing a simple and effective way to measure network performance.
  • No Installation Required
    PsPing is a portable tool that doesn't require installation, making it convenient to use on different systems without administrative privileges.

Possible disadvantages of PsPing

  • Limited to Windows
    As a Sysinternals tool, PsPing is designed for Windows, which limits its use in environments where other operating systems are prevalent.
  • Command-Line Limitations
    While powerful, the command-line interface might be intimidating or less intuitive for users who are more comfortable with graphical interfaces.
  • Dependency on Network Configuration
    Accurate measurements depend on network configuration and permissions, such as ICMP traffic being allowed, which might not be the case in all networks.
  • Learning Curve
    Users unfamiliar with command-line tools or networking concepts might face a learning curve in understanding and effectively using all of PsPing's features.
  • No Full-Scale Management Features
    PsPing is primarily a diagnostic tool and lacks the broader network management capabilities found in more comprehensive network monitoring solutions.

iperf features and specs

  • Cross-Platform Compatibility
    iperf is compatible with a variety of operating systems including Windows, Linux, and macOS, making it a versatile tool for network performance testing across different environments.
  • Comprehensive Performance Metrics
    Provides detailed metrics such as bandwidth, jitter, and packet loss, which are essential for in-depth network analysis and troubleshooting.
  • Client-Server Model
    Utilizes a client-server model that allows for measuring the maximum TCP and UDP bandwidth between two endpoints, making it suitable for both local and remote testing.
  • Open Source
    Being open-source, iperf allows users to review, modify, and contribute to the codebase, ensuring transparency and fostering community involvement.
  • Customizable Test Parameters
    Allows users to customize tests with various parameters such as port number, buffer size, and test duration, offering flexibility to perform targeted network evaluations.

Possible disadvantages of iperf

  • Complexity for Beginners
    The command-line interface and numerous parameters might be overwhelming for beginners who are not familiar with network testing tools.
  • Limited Graphical Interface
    While powerful in functionality, iperf lacks a native graphical user interface, which could be a disadvantage for users who prefer visual tools over command-line utilities.
  • Resource Consumption
    iperf can consume substantial network resources and CPU power during testing, potentially affecting other applications running on the same network or device.
  • Manual Deployment Required
    Users need to manually deploy iperf on both client and server machines, which may be cumbersome for those looking for out-of-the-box network testing solutions.
  • Security Considerations
    Running iperf in server mode might expose a system to network attacks if not secured properly, necessitating careful consideration of security measures.
